Unregistered Acornhoek Pharmacy owner and his employees arrested

A 50-year-old pharmacy owner, and his four employees have been arrested for Contravention of the Medical and Related Substances Act and Contravention of the regulations relating to the Ownership and Licensing of Pharmacies Act today by the Hawks.

The team operationalised information received from SAHPRA about the pharmacy's unlawful activities.

A search warrant was executed at the business. Four employees were found behind the counter doing business as usual. The employees could not produce their qualifications to operate in a pharmacy, especially dispensing medicines.

The owner was not at his establishment when the warrant was executed, but he was summoned to the scene. On his arrival, he could neither produce the operating license nor valid qualifications. It was established that the pharmacy was not even registered with the South African pharmacy council.

Scheduled medicines, ranging from schedules 1 to 6, were seized. Currently, the Hawks cannot confirm the value of the seized medicines as further investigation and expert analysis is still to be conducted.

SIU raids Hangwani Maumela’s Sandton home over Tembisa Hospital tender fraud

The Special Investigating Unit (SIU) has executed a high-profile raid on the Sandton residence of businessman Hangwani Morgan Maumela, seizing luxury vehicles and artwork valued at R820 million.

This operation is part of an extensive investigation into corruption at Tembisa Hospital, where Maumela is implicated in a syndicate that allegedly siphoned over R2 billion from public healthcare funds.

1st annual Mpumalanga investment and mining conference launched

MEC for Economic Development and Tourism, Ms. Jesta Sidel, has today joined the Premier, Mr. Mandla Ndlovu to the inaugural Mpumalanga Investment and Mining Conference held under the theme "Driving Investment for a sustainable and inclusive economy" at Middelburg, in the Steve Tshwete Local municipality.

The Mpumalanga Investment and Mining Conference is a drive to attract investors to the province.

50 billion in pledges is expected to be made from the conference and the funds will go towards uplifting the province's economy by creating jobs

Mozambican fined 150K for smuggling fake shoes worth 12 million

A 46-year-old Mozambican national (Eurico Zandamela) forfeited sportswear worth more than R12 million.

This after he was arrested at Lebombo Port of Entry after he tried to smuggle counterfeit goods from Mozambique to South Africa on 23 February 2024.

The driver, Zandamela, was the lone occupant of the truck. He allegedly colluded with a 32-year-old South African security guard, Sibusiso Ngwenya, who allegedly tried to assist Zandamela to bypass the system. Ngwenya, a security guard working for the security company that is contracted at the Port of Entry.

The Port of Entry employees smelled a rat that illicit activities were underway when the truck was directed to queue on the line of the unloaded vehicles. The officials decided to search the truck and found different brands of counterfeit sportswear, including Adidas, Nike, Diesel, CAT, Puma, LaPorte, New balance, and Redbat. The recovered items valued at R12 526 544 were concealed in the truck trailer.

Both the driver and the security guard were arrested and items seized. The case was handed over to the Hawks Nelspruit based Serious Commercial Crime Investigation for further handling. Zandamela and Ngwenya were released on R5 000 bail each.

On Tuesday, 30 September 2025, Zandamela pleaded guilty and was sentenced to a fine of R150 000.00- or three-months imprisonment by the Mbombela Specialised Commercial Crimes Court. Half of his sentence was suspended for five years on condition that he is not found guilty of the similar offense. All the recovered counterfeit goods were forfeited to the state.

Ngwenya pleaded not guilty, and his case was postponed to 11 December 2025 to prove his innocence.

Skeleton found in Buikhutso Bushbuckridge

Police in Bushbuckridge have opened an inquest docket after finding human remains in the bushes near Boikhutso Trust, Bushbuckridge, yesterday .

The remains, believed to be those of an unknown male, were found in a severely burned condition. A pair of brown sneakers was recovered next to the skeletal remains. The circumstances surrounding the death are currently under investigation.

Police are appealing to members of the community who may be missing a loved one, or who may have information that could assist in identifying the deceased, to come forward.

Hazyview Mashonisa dodges prison term

The White River Magistrate's Court has sentenced Bernard Ndlovu (53) an administration clerk attached to Hazyview SAPS to one year imprisonment with an option to pay R30 000 fine wholly suspended for three years.

This after he was arrested two years ago, on 21 July 2023, when he was found in possession of 140 different bank and SASSA cards. Investigation revealed that Ndlovu was conducting an unregistered cash loan business.

When clients borrowed money, Ndlovu took his clients' cards as security to ensure his money was paid back. He was arrested for the Contravention of the National Credit Act.

In a vibrant corner of Mpumalanga kamphatseni rural village , young entrepreneurs Phumlani Mbowani and Trevor Mdluli are taking a stand against the challenges of unemployment and crime.

These boys, full of hope and determination, have chosen to forge their own path by establishing a unique business: a sneaker washing service named Kamphatseni Ezabo Sneaker Market. This venture began in early 2024 as a proactive step to keep themselves out of trouble while contributing positively to their community.
